PostSharp.Patterns.Caching.Backends Namespace |
This namespace contains implementations of adapters for specific caching back-ends.

Class | Description | |
---|---|---|
![]() | MemoryCacheBackend |
A CachingBackend based on Microsoft.Extensions.Caching.Memory.IMemoryCache (IMemoryCache).
This cache is recommended for ASP.NET Core use (as opposed to System.Runtime.Caching.MemoryCache).

![]() | MemoryCachingBackend |
A CachingBackend based on System.Runtime.Caching.MemoryCache (MemoryCache). This cache is part of .NET Framework
and is available for .NET Standard in the NuGet package System.Runtime.Caching.
|
![]() | NonBlockingCachingBackendEnhancer |
A CachingBackendEnhancer that modifies all write operations to run in the background and
immediately return to the caller.
|
![]() | NullCachingBackend |
An implementation of CachingBackend that does not cache at all.
|
![]() | TwoLayerCachingBackendEnhancer |
A CachingBackendEnhancer that adds a local (fast) MemoryCachingBackend to a remote (slower) cache.
This class is typically instantiate in the back-end factory method. You should normally not use this class unless you develop a custom caching back-end.
